In thirteenth-century England, King Henry III's sister Nell breaks tradition and marries Simon de Montfort, an outspoken nobleman who risks death in battle to preserve honor. This is Simon de Montfort's story--and the story of King Henry III, as weak and changeable as Montfort was brash and unbending.
